Right-hand Hinge for 400 Series Frenchwood Hinged Patio Doors in Oil Rubbed Bronze Finish

Contents: Includes single hinge (leaf and hinge receiver), screws, and instruction guide.

Specifications:

  • Overall Width: 3-1/16 Inches
  • Door Panel Length: 3-15/16 Inches
  • Door Jamb Length: 4-1/4 Inches
  • Handed: Yes
  • Color(s): Oil Rubbed Bronze

Note:

Andersen had 3 generations of hinges:
1. 1989-1991: These hinges had one hole in the center of the tab.
2. 1992 to November 2005: This generation had two holes.
3. November 2005 to present: These hinges are totally different and require modification if being used to replace older hinges.

The first two generations of Andersen hinge are interchangeable, but installing the present hinges requires enlarging the receiver hole and routing the door panel (See the first article below).
